Wayne County Program Coordinator
This is a Hourly, Part-Time position is responsible to provide support for the Wayne County program and program director.
Program Coordinator should have a strong knowledge of the day-to-day operations of their program, particularly as it relates to contract compliance, service delivery, and the participants intake/referral process for services. The work has less to do with general office duties than with assisting in the operation or administration of a local program/unit. Position will also perform Advocate duties. Applicant must be dependable, committed, and able to serve as a positive role model for youth in community, school, and home settings.
The position offers flexible hours, competitive weekly pay, and activity reimbursement. Hourly Rate: $20.00-$22.00
